This attractive semi-detached, Victorian, four-storey town house, situated in popular Princes Street and within a walk of the High Street, station and local schools.
The property retains much of its original charm including fireplaces, wooden floors and bay windows. The house is immaculately presented by the current owner with scope to further convert and extend (subject to Planningg Permission). The kitchen and dining room are located at the back of the house with a fireplace in the dining room and a door leading to the patio area of the garden. The sitting room has a large pretty bay window with colonial shutters and a Victorian-style fireplace. From the hall there are stairs leading to the basement which currently has storage, a WC and separate shower room. There are also stairs from the hall to the first floor with the principal bedroom having a bay window to the front, colonial shutters and wooden floor. There is a second double bedroom with views over the garden and beyond. On the top floor, bedroom 3 shares the space with an en suite bathroom.
The property has a courtyard garden to the front with attractive railings enhancing the character of the house. Side access takes you to the rear garden which is fenced and mainly laid to lawn with a patio ideal for a table. There is a large shed situated towards the end of the garden.
